From owner-freebsd-questions@FreeBSD.ORG Sat Jan 14 23:05:41 2012 Return-Path: Delivered-To: freebsd-questions@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 345F4106564A for ; Sat, 14 Jan 2012 23:05:41 +0000 (UTC) (envelope-from jrisom@gmail.com) Received: from mail-iy0-f182.google.com (mail-iy0-f182.google.com [209.85.210.182]) by mx1.freebsd.org (Postfix) with ESMTP id EE87E8FC08 for ; Sat, 14 Jan 2012 23:05:40 +0000 (UTC) Received: by iagz16 with SMTP id z16so2387769iag.13 for ; Sat, 14 Jan 2012 15:05:40 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=message-id:date:from:user-agent:mime-version:to:subject:references :in-reply-to:content-type:content-transfer-encoding; bh=usH7pLPptTIaLxjvHOTcLKXx7i0COP4NmpUfSaUqh+0=; b=f+f6cO8V8tWjpobrBfBHJCmpY54NZpPD1pT+gXO2E7rIsOJQXv9qpW/gSOSYqOKqK2 jricu/e3sSRzt0HADH9nOI8l+Ger6NsR7KZEyABOz43+bTJDcpGvkq2CPOLEvOV/k3lQ vx9injk/DEFt9O8rVLYoCs4Sb6gqJ9A7EBtQw= Received: by 10.50.207.72 with SMTP id lu8mr6633143igc.0.1326580810706; Sat, 14 Jan 2012 14:40:10 -0800 (PST) Received: from [192.168.1.3] (c-98-212-197-29.hsd1.il.comcast.net. [98.212.197.29]) by mx.google.com with ESMTPS id x18sm45798716ibi.2.2012.01.14.14.40.09 (version=SSLv3 cipher=OTHER); Sat, 14 Jan 2012 14:40:09 -0800 (PST) Message-ID: <4F120436.5070506@gmail.com> Date: Sat, 14 Jan 2012 16:39:50 -0600 From: Joshua Isom User-Agent: Mozilla/5.0 (Windows NT 6.0; rv:8.0) Gecko/20111105 Thunderbird/8.0 MIME-Version: 1.0 To: freebsd-questions@freebsd.org References: <473d0ac7158a466fc4bf2b877de83a8e@www.dweimer.net> In-Reply-To: <473d0ac7158a466fc4bf2b877de83a8e@www.dweimer.net>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it Subject: Re: 9.0 buildworld problems X-BeenThere: freebsd-questions@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: User questions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 14 Jan 2012 23:05:41 -0000 On 1/14/2012 3:02 PM, Dean E. Weimer wrote: > I am trying to build a test system to verify everything works on FreeBSD > 9.0-RELEASE, I started with a standard install on a VMware virtual > machine. I used portsnap fetch extract to install the ports tree, copied > the /etc/make.conf and /etc/src.conf from my existing 8.2 system onto > the new test system. > > Contents of /etc/make.conf: > # Use OpenSSL from ports instead of base > WITH_OPENSSL_PORT=yes > # Avoid Building Ports Against X > WITHOUT_X11=yes > # Some Default Options From /usr/share/examples/etc/make.conf > CFLAGS= -O -pipe > NO_PROFILE=true > # Enable SMTP Authentication > SENDMAIL_CFLAGS=-I/usr/local/include/sasl -DSASL > SENDMAIL_LDFLAGS=-L/usr/local/lib > SENDMAIL_LDADD=-lsasl2 > # Enable Proxy For Ports Fetch > FETCH_ENV=http_proxy=http://192.168.5.1:3128 > FETCH_ENV=ftp_proxy=http://192.168.5.1:3128 > # added by use.perl 2012-01-14 12:46:15 > PERL_VERSION=5.12.4 > > Contents of /etc/src.conf: > WITHOUT_BIND_DNSSEC="YES" > WITHOUT_BIND_LIBS_LWRES="YES" > WITHOUT_BIND_NAMED="YES" > WITHOUT_BIND_UTILS="YES" > WITHOUT_NTP="YES" > > > I then installed openssl, vim-lite, and cvsup-without-gui from ports, > copied the example standard-supfile to a new location, changed the host= > line, left the rest as default options. Ran cvsup to download source > tree, ran make -j16 buildworld from the /usr/src directory. > > The buildworld stoped here: > ===> gnu/lib/libsupc++ (install) > sh /usr/src/tools/install.sh -C -o root -g wheel -m 444 libsupc++.a > /usr/obj/usr/src/tmp/usr/lib > sh /usr/src/tools/install.sh -C -o root -g wheel -m 444 > /usr/src/gnu/lib/libsupc++/../../../contrib/libstdc++/libsupc++/exception /usr/src/gnu/lib/libsupc++/../../../contrib/libstdc++/libsupc++/new > /usr/src/gnu/lib/libsupc++/../../../contrib/libstdc++/libsupc++/typeinfo > /usr/src/gnu/lib/libsupc++/../../../contrib/libstdc++/libsupc++/cxxabi.h > /usr/src/gnu/lib/libsupc++/../../../contrib/libstdc++/libsupc++/exception_defines.h > /usr/obj/usr/src/tmp/usr/include/c++/4.2 > 1 error > *** Error code 2 > 1 error > *** Error code 2 > 1 error > *** Error code 2 > 1 error > > I cleaned everything up and retried, it died at the same spot on the > next run as well. I have the full output of the buildwolrd process on my > webserver, > > Interestingly enough at the same time I was building this system I was > also testing an upgrade from source option on different virtual machine > that was made from a restore of live system, after downloading the > FreeBSD9.0 source tree and running buildworld from usr/src against > copies of the same make.conf and src.conf file above, it built fine and > the install process ran successfully. The ports have all been rebuilt, > and I am going to try a new buildworld to see if it succeeds or fails on > that system now that its running 9.0 instead of 8.2 when the last > buidlworld was ran on it. > Run `make -DNO_CLEAN buildworld`. Because you used -j6, there's no way to know what went wrong without a full log, and even with a full log it'll be a pain.